
Jordan Brand is launching a new Air Jordan 4 in the "Cave Stone" color scheme during Fall 2025, available in full family sizing.
UPDATE 04/06/2025: Check out the first images below of the new Air Jordan 4 Retro "Cave Stone" releasing during Fall 2025.
UPDATE 11/19/2024: According to zSneakerHeadz (via X, formerly Twitter), the Air Jordan 4 Retro pair is scheduled to release on September 6, 2025. He also shared a new mock-up featuring a black outsole, using color-blocking similar to the Travis Scott collaboration. For now, Nike has not yet announced the release date.
UPDATE 12/13/2024: According to Sneaker Files (via X, formerly Twitter), the Air Jordan 4 Retro pair comes with Nike Air branding on the heel. Nike has modified the product code for this model over the past few weeks. Although the product was initially set to release with product code FQ8138 (the version with the Jumpman on the heel), according to several industry sources the new model will launch with product code FV5029 (the version with Nike Air on the heel).
According to multiple sources, Nike is working on a new Air Jordan 4 for Fall 2025. The information first appeared on X (formerly Twitter) from Elden Monitors. There, he mentioned that the model is scheduled to release during Fall 2025 in a full family size run. The pair comes in a "Cave Stone / Black / Moon Particle" color scheme. The exact color blocking is not yet known, but we already have a mock-up (attached below) showing a possible colorway. The color scheme is similar to the Travis Scott x Air Jordan 4 Retro "Olive" F&F pair. The Travis Scott collaboration was released only to the artist’s friends and family. At the moment, Nike has not confirmed the release rumor. In general, Nike avoids confirming rumors about limited-edition drops.
When is the Air Jordan 4 Retro “Cave Stone” releasing?
The Air Jordan 4 Retro "Cave Stone" is releasing during Fall 2025 on Nike.com and at select Air Jordan Retro partner stores. The release date has not yet been officially announced. However, the pair is part of the Nike Fall 2025 seasonal catalog, so we expect the new model to launch between July and September 2025.
